tpwallet_tpwallet官网下载中文正版/苹果版-虚拟货币钱包下载

TP钱包是否开源?解析实时资产评估、实时支付、多链集成与HD钱包等关键能力

关于“TP钱包是否开源?”——

需要先澄清:TP钱包(常被称为TPWallet或相关品牌的多链钱包产品)在行业里通常以“客户端应用+链上交互能力”为主,是否“完全开源”取决于其具体组件与对应版本。一般来说,钱包项目可能出现三种情况:

1)核心代码部分开源(例如某些SDK、前端/组件库、示例代码或协议交互库);

2)使用了开源依赖,但主体工程未公开;

3)存在开源仓库但并不覆盖全部生产环境功能。

因此,仅凭“TP钱包”这一名称,很难在不核验官方仓库与许可条款的情况下给出绝对结论。建议你以“官方是否在GitHub/Gitee等发布源代码仓库、仓库覆盖范围、许可证(MIT/Apache/GPL等)、以及与主版本是否一致”为判断标准。

下面我在不依赖“是否完全开源”的前提下,详细讲解你提到的几个核心模块:实时资产评估、实时支付平台、多链资产集成、金融科技发展方案、科技报告、HD钱包、数字支付。重点会放在“这些能力如何构建、价值是什么、实现要点有哪些”。

一、实时资产评估(Real-time Asset Valuation)

1)目标

实时资产评估的核心是:让用户在钱包里看到“资产数量”之外,还能看到“价值(通常折算为法币)”。它要求系统在用户操作或资产状态变化时,快速获取最新价格与资产清单,并进行一致性计算。

2)常见数据来源

- 链上数据:余额、代币转账事件、持仓快照等。

- 价格数据:交易所行情、聚合器报价、价格预言机(用于某些DeFi资产的参考)、或第三方行情API。

- 汇率数据:例如USD/USDT与CNY的换算。

3)评估流程(典型架构)

- 钱包端触发:用户打开资产页、切换网络、完成交易后。

- 资产拉取:对多链地址执行余额查询(原生币种与ERC-20/同类代币、NFT等分别处理)。

- 价格拉取:按资产类型选择价格源(稳定币尽量用锚定机制或权威行情;其他代币按流动性/交易对选择)。

- 计算与聚合:资产价值=余额×价格,统一到同一法币单位。

- 缓存与刷新策略:为兼顾速度与准确性,常采用短周期缓存(例如1-30秒)、异常回退(若行情不可用则使用上次有效数据并标记“延迟/估值”)。

4)关键难点

- 价格一致性:同一资产在不同API中可能存在偏差,要定义“可接受误差”与优先级。

- 处理延迟:链上余额更新有确认时间差,前端要做“等待确认/乐观显示”。

- 风险标记:当价格源异常或流动性极低,需提示“估值可能不准确”。

二、实时支付平台(Real-time Payment Platform)

1)目标

实时支付平台让用户能在钱包内完成“收款/付款/扣款/确认”的闭环体验,并保证链上确认、账单状态与通知的可追溯。

2)支付模型

- 链上直接转账:由用户签名并广播交易,支付完成后等待区块确认。

- 托管式或聚合式支付:通过服务端代为生成交易、提供路由与费用估算(需更严格的安全与合规设计)。

- 账单与支付链接:例如生成支付URI/二维码,收款方或商户可追踪状态。

3)状态机设计(常见)

- 已创建(Created)

- 待签名(Pending Signature)

- 已广播(Broadcasted)

- 已确认/成功(Confirmed / Succeeded)

- 失败(Failed)

- 退款/撤销(Refunded/Cancelled,如有)

4)关键能力

- 实时费率与网络选择:在拥堵时选择更优Gas策略或链路。

- 防重放与防篡改:支付请求应包含nonce、签名校验、有效期。

- 对账与审计:商户或内部系统需要可追踪的交易ID、时间戳、链上hash。

三、多链资产集成(Multi-chain Asset Integration)

1)目标

多链资产集成让用户在同一个钱包界面管理多条链(如EVM链、非EVM链等)。其本质是“统一资产模型 + 统一交互层”。

2)统一资产模型

- 原生币种:例如ETH、BNB等。

- 同标准代币:ERC-20/及兼容标准、TRC-20等。

- NFT:不同链的代币ID、元数据与展示方式。

- 跨链资产:桥接资产、包装代币(Wrapped Token),需要标识来源与赎回路径。

3)实现要点

- 钱包地址与派生:对不同链采用对应的地址编码规则(EVM与某些链差异显著)。

- RPC/节点适配:每条链可能不同的RPC风格、错误码、确认机制。

- 交易构造:合约交互(合约ABI)、gas估算、nonce管理。

- 失败回退:网络不通、合约调用失败、滑点过高等都要有策略。

4)安全与风险

- 链上权限与签名:必须严格显示签名内容(to、data摘要、额度、授权范围)。

- 代币识别:避免恶意代币“同名欺骗”,需要合约地址为准。

四、金融科技发展方案(Financial Technology Development Plan)

1)定位与原则

一个“钱包+支付+估值”的金融科技方案,关键不是堆功能,而是形成可持续的产品闭环:

- 用户端体验:快、稳、低风险。

- 服务端能力:价格、支付路由、风控、对账。

- 合规与安全:审计、权限、KYC/AML(视业务形态而定)。

2)建议的分阶段路线

- 第一阶段:基础多链资产管理 + 估值(价格聚合与缓存)

- 第二阶段:链上支付闭环(收款码/链接、状态机与通知)

- 第三阶段:商户能力与风控(交易限额、异常检测、反洗钱策略)

- 第四阶段:金融产品化(例如资产管理、质押/理财入口、但必须把风险教育放在前面)

3)团队与能力建设

- 区块链工程:多链适配、交易构造与签名。

- 数据工程:行情、聚合、清洗、延迟监控。

- 安全工程:私钥保护、签名流程、权限隔离。

- 业务与合规:支付场景的监管要求与风控规则。

五、科技报告(Technology Report)应该包含什么

如果你在做“金融科技发展方案”的汇报或落地文档,科技报告常见结构如下:

1)摘要与目标

- 业务目标:例如提升支付成功率、降低估值延迟、增强多链覆盖。

2)系统架构

- 钱包端、链上交互层、服务端行情与支付服务、风控与日志。

3)关键指标(KPI)

- 估值刷新延迟(ms/s)

- 价格源可用率与回退率

- 支付成功率、确认时间分布

- 交易失败原因统计https://www.0-002.com ,(gas、合约错误、链拥堵)

4)安全与风控

- 私钥/助记词/HD派生策略

- 授权交易风险控制(例如限制无限授权提示)

- 异常检测(高频失败、可疑收款、异常地址活跃度)

5)测试与审计

- 单元测试、链上回放测试

- 合约调用边界测试

- 代码审计与依赖漏洞管理

6)路线图与预算

- 下一阶段开发清单

- 成本构成(RPC、行情API、服务器、审计)

六、HD钱包(Hierarchical Deterministic Wallet)

1)概念

HD钱包通过“主密钥→派生子密钥”的方式生成一棵密钥树,使得同一份种子可以按路径派生出无穷多个地址。

2)常见标准

- BIP39:助记词(Mnemonic)与种子生成。

- BIP32:层级确定性(从主密钥派生子密钥)。

- BIP44/SLIP-0044:账户/链/地址索引的路径规范。

3)优势

- 地址可恢复:只要拥有助记词/种子即可恢复。

- 地址管理更安全:避免重复使用同一地址带来的隐私风险。

- 备份成本可控:用户备份的是助记词,不需要备份每个地址的私钥。

4)实现要点与风险

- 路径设计:不同链与地址标准需要不同推导规则。

- 助记词安全:必须在本地生成与加密存储;避免上传明文。

- 设备安全:应支持安全隔离区/加密存储(取决于平台)。

七、数字支付(Digital Payments)

1)支付的本质

数字支付是把“价值交换”数字化,并通过网络实现“即时或接近即时”的确认与结算。

2)与区块链钱包结合的关键点

- 确认机制:交易确认需要区块时间与最终性策略(短确认/深确认)。

- 费用呈现:让用户清晰了解网络费(Gas/手续费)与可能的波动。

- 兼容多资产:不仅是链上币,也可能是代币(ERC-20等)。

- 纠纷处理:订单号、链上hash、对账单据要能追溯。

3)用户体验要点

- 支付成功/失败明确可见

- 失败可重试建议(例如更换网络费率、重新构建交易)

- 风险提示:例如高波动资产或不确定价格的估值标注

最后:如何把这些内容真正落到“TP钱包”的理解上

- 若你关心“TP钱包是否开源”,核心是核验官方仓库与覆盖范围:仅凭名称无法定论;建议检查是否有对应的开源SDK/客户端工程与许可证。

- 不论是否开源,上述功能都属于典型“钱包能力栈”:

- 资产管理依赖多链与HD钱包(私钥与地址派生)

- 估值依赖实时行情与价格聚合

- 支付依赖链上交易构造、状态机、对账与通知

- 金融科技方案/科技报告则是把工程指标与业务目标对齐

如果你愿意,你可以把你看到的TP钱包“官方链接/开源仓库地址/具体版本号”发我,我可以根据你提供的信息进一步判断:它是“完全开源、部分开源还是主要依赖开源但主体闭源”,并把上述模块与该版本的实际实现边界对应起来。

作者:沈岚 发布时间:2026-05-23 12:15:10

相关阅读